本发明专利技术提供用于基于所检测到的示意动作执行动作的系统和方法。本文中所提供的所述系统和方法可检测初始无接触示意动作的方向且基于所述初始无接触示意动作的所述方向处理后续无接触示意动作。所述系统和方法可基于所述所检测到的方向转换与用户装置相关的坐标系和示意动作库以使得可基于所述所检测到的方向处理后续无接触示意动作。所述系统和方法可允许用户不依赖于装置的定向而在所述装置上方作出无接触示意动作以与所述装置互动,这是因为所述初始示意动作的所述方向可针对后续示意动作检测设定所述坐标系或情境。
【技术实现步骤摘要】
【国外来华专利技术】
本文中所揭示的实施例大体上涉及用于基于所检测到的示意动作执行装置动作 的系统和方法。具体来说,本文中所揭示的实施例可允许用户使用不依赖于装置的定向的 示意动作执行动作。
技术介绍
电子装置变得愈来愈先进。许多装置现在包含不仅可用于检测关于装置的信息还 可用于指示装置执行功能的各种摄像机或其它传感器。举例来说,一些装置现在能够检测 和处理示意动作以执行命令。对于基于所检测到的示意动作执行装置动作的经改进的系统 和方法,存在需求。
技术实现思路
根据一些实施例,提供用于执行动作的装置。所述装置包含示意动作检测传感器, 所述示意动作检测传感器经配置以检测在装置上方移动的控制对象的移动以及捕获与所 检测到的移动相关的信息,并且检测在装置上方执行的无接触示意动作以及捕获与所述无 接触示意动作相关的信息。所述装置还包含一或多个处理器,所述一或多个处理器经配置 以根据与所检测到的移动相关的所捕获的信息来确定控制对象的运动方向,且基于与无接 触示意动作相关的信息所相关的所捕获的信息和经确定的运动方向执行动作。 根据一些实施例,还提供用于执行动作的方法。所述方法包含:检测在装置上方 移动的控制对象的运动;确定控制对象的移动方向;检测在装置上方执行的无接触示意动 作;和基于所检测到的无接触示意动作和经确定的运动方向执行动作。所提供的方法也可 实施为计算机可读媒体上的指令。 根据一些实施例,还提供用于基于所检测到的无接触示意动作执行动作的方法。 所述方法包含:检测在装置上方经过的第一个示意动作;确定所检测到的第一个示意动作 是否匹配示意动作库中的已知示意动作或所期望的示意动作;当所检测到的第一个示意动 作不匹配示意动作库中的已知示意动作或所期望的示意动作时基于所检测到的第一个示 意动作的经确定的方向转换与装置相关联的坐标系;以及当确定第二个所检测到的示意动 作匹配示意动作库中的已知示意动作或已基于经转换的坐标系转换的所期望的示意动作 时基于第二个所检测到的示意动作执行动作。 根据一些实施例,还提供用于执行动作的系统。所述系统包含:用于检测在装置上 方移动的控制对象的移动的装置;用于确定控制对象的移动方向的装置;用于检测在装置 上方执行的无接触示意动作的装置;用于基于所检测到的无接触示意动作和经确定的移动 方向执行动作的装置。 根据一些实施例,进一步提供包含以下各者的方法:检测在装置附近执行的第一 个无接触示意动作;基于第一个无接触示意动作确定用于示意动作解译的坐标系;检测在 第一个无接触示意动作之后执行的第二个无接触示意动作;以及基于第二个无接触示意动 作和经确定的坐标系在装置上执行命令。在一些实施例中,确定坐标系可包含确定坐标系 的对准和定向中的至少一者。检测第一个无接触示意动作可包含检测在装置上方的滑动, 且其中确定坐标系可包含设定坐标系以便与滑动的方向对准。检测第一个无接触示意动作 可包含检测在装置上方的手姿势,且其中确定坐标系可包含设定坐标系以便与所检测到的 手姿势的定向对准。相较于在检测第一个无接触示意动作之前定向坐标系,可以不同方式 定向经确定的坐标系。检测第一个无接触示意动作可包含检测实质上呈圆形形状或其部分 的移动。 所述方法还可包含:检测第三个无接触示意动作,所述第三个无接触示意动作为 用于复位坐标系的示意动作;检测第四个无接触示意动作;和基于第四个无接触示意动作 确定用于示意动作解译的坐标系。检测第四个无接触示意动作可包含检测在装置上方的滑 动和在装置上方的手姿势中的至少一者,且其中确定坐标系可包含设定坐标系以便与滑动 的方向和手姿势的定向中的至少一者对准。检测第三个无接触示意动作可包含在检测第一 个无接触示意动作之前检测第三个无接触示意动作。【附图说明】 图1为根据一些实施例的说明处理装置100的图式。 图2为根据一些实施例的说明使用无接触示意动作与计算装置互动的实例的图 式。 图3A和3B为根据一些实施例的说明转换与装置相关联的坐标系的图式。 图4A和4B为根据一些实施例的说明基于经转换的坐标系处理所检测到的示意动 作的实例的图式。 图5为根据一些实施例的说明呈许多定向的相同示意动作的图式。 图6A和6B为根据一些实施例的说明执行一不意动作以复位坐标系的实例的图 式。 图7A和7B为根据一些实施例的说明基于经转换的坐标系显示文本的实例的图 式。 图8为根据一些实施例的说明用于基于经确定的方向执行动作的过程的流程图。 图9为根据一些实施例的说明用于基于经确定的坐标系执行动作的过程的流程 图。 图10为根据一些实施例的说明用于基于所检测到的无接触示意动作执行动作的 过程的流程图。 在图示中,具有相同名称的元件具有相同的或相似的功能。【具体实施方式】 在以下描述中,阐述描述某些实施例的具体细节。然而,对于所属领域的技术人 员将显而易见的是,所揭示的实施例可以在没有这些具体细节中的一些或全部的情况下实 践。所呈现的具体实施例意图为说明性的而非限制性的。所属领域的技术人员可以认识到 其它材料尽管未具体描述于本文中,但其处于本专利技术范围和精神内。 示意动作可在(例如)免提或无需眼睛的情形下适用。在此类情形下,用户可以 不直接注视装置或甚至手拿装置,且使用示意动作代替实际上注视装置或拿起装置。此外, 由于用户可能不在注视装置或手拿装置,因此用户可能不知道装置所处的定向,并且,如果 示意动作为方向依赖性的,例如,从左到右的滑动,那么如果不知道定向就可能难以完成所 述示意动作,这是因为装置可能识别不出用户认为是从左到右走向但归因于装置的定向实 际上为自上而下走向的示意动作。因此,对于能够基于不依赖于装置的定向的示意动作执 行装置动作的系统和方法,存在需求。 图1为根据一些实施例的说明处理装置100的图式。处理装置100可为:移 动装置,例如智能手机(例如iPhone?);或运行iOS?操作系统、Android?操作系统、 BlackBerry?操作系统、Microsori? Windows? Phone 操作系统、Symbian? OS 或 webOS? 的其它移动装置;或不实施操作系统的移动装置。处理装置100还可为例如iPad?的平板 计算机或运行前述操作系统中的一者的其它平板计算机。处理装置100也可以是PC或膝上 型计算机或上网本、机顶盒(STB)(例如由电缆或卫星内容提供商提供),或视频游戏系统 控制台(例如Nintendo?. Wii?、Microsoft? Xbox 360?或 Sony? PlayStation? 3)或其它 视频游戏系统控制台。处理装置100可为头戴式显示器(HMD)或其它可穿戴式计算装置。 在一些实施例中,处理装置100在汽车中实施,例如在汽车的娱乐中心或控制台中,或包含 或实施于医疗装置中。根据一些实施例,处理装置100可使用经配置以用于检测示意动作 和部分地基于所检测到的示意动作执行动作的硬件和/或软件的任何适当的组合来实施。 具体来说,处理装置100可包含硬件和/或软件的任何适当的组合,所述硬件和/或软件的 任何适当的组合具有一或多个处理器,且能够读取储存在非暂时性机器可读媒体上的以由 一或多个处理器执行的指令以检测示意动作和部分地基于所检测到的示本文档来自技高网...

【技术保护点】
一种用于执行动作的方法,其包括:通过耦合到装置或整合在装置中的第一示意动作检测传感器检测在所述装置上方移动的控制对象的运动;通过所述装置的一或多个处理器确定所述控制对象的移动方向;通过第二示意动作检测传感器检测在所述装置上方执行的无接触示意动作;以及通过一或多个处理器基于所述所检测到的无接触示意动作和所述经确定的移动方向执行动作。
【技术特征摘要】
【国外来华专利技术】...
【专利技术属性】
技术研发人员:S·K·古普塔,V·W·基廷,E·R·希尔德雷思,
申请(专利权)人:高通股份有限公司,
类型:发明
国别省市:美国;US
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。